A calculus teacher is responsible for instructing students in the principles and applications of calculus, a branch of mathematics that deals with rates of change and accumulation. They design lesson plans, deliver lectures, facilitate discussions, and provide guidance to help students grasp complex mathematical concepts. Calculus teachers assess student progress through assignments, quizzes, and exams, and provide feedback and support to help students improve their understanding and skills.
Additionally, a calculus teacher may assist students in applying calculus to real-world problems, encourage critical thinking and problem-solving skills, and foster a strong foundation in mathematical reasoning. They may also collaborate with other teachers, participate in professional development activities, and stay updated with current teaching methods and technology.

Calculus Teacher salary in Ghana
Average Yearly Salary of Calculus Teacher in Ghana is approximately 42,602 GHS (3,552 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Ghana is a country located in West Africa. It has a population of approximately 31 million people and covers an area of about 238,535 square kilometers. The country is bordered by Cote d'Ivoire to the west, Burkina Faso to the north, Togo to the east, and the Atlantic Ocean to the south.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 39,200 GHS (3,500 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Calculus Teacher job salary compared to average salary in Ghana.
Comparison shows that a person working as Calculus Teacher in Ghana earns on average:
1.09 times the average salary (or 109% of average salary).
